// When running on either terminal, cmd, or any other compiler,
// please do remember to use the argument of the text file; otherwise
// it wil not run and prompt that you do enter an argument, an example
// will appear
//java SpellCheckerSuggestion Text1.txt
import java.io.*;
import java.util.*;
public class SpellCheckerSuggestion {
public static ArrayList<String> dictionary = new ArrayList<String>();
public static ArrayList<String> text = new ArrayList<String>();
//new arraylist that holds all the suggestions
public static ArrayList<String> suggestions = new ArrayList<String>();
public static void main(String[] args) throws IOException, FileNotFoundException {
dictionary();
//if no argument is is passed through
if(args.length == 0) {
System.out.println("\nYou have not entered a file you would like to spell check; \nPlease type one of the file inputs after the argument so that we can spell check it");
System.out.println("\neg: java SpellCheckerSuggestion Text1.txt");
return;
}
try {
textFile(args[0]);
dictionary();
compareFiles();
}
catch(FileNotFoundException e){
System.out.println("\nYou have entered an invalid text file you would like to run; please check what the input of the tezt file that you're using is\n");
}
}
// Method to add strings into the dictionary arraylist
// Adding to arraylist so that if two words are similar it will parse through
public static void dictionary() throws FileNotFoundException {
File diction = new File("dictionary.txt");
Scanner sc1 = new Scanner(diction);
while (sc1.hasNext()) {
dictionary.add(sc1.next());
}
}
// Method that adds the next word into the text arraylist
public static void textFile(String s) throws FileNotFoundException {
File spelling = new File(s);
Scanner sc2 = new Scanner(spelling);
while(sc2.hasNext()) {
text.add(sc2.next());
}
}
// Looks at individual text string against dictionary arraylist
public static void compareFiles() throws IOException {
for(int i = 0; i < text.size(); i++) {
String puncc = text.get(i).replaceAll("(?!\")\\p{Punct}", "");
String punc = puncc.toLowerCase();
if(dictionary.contains(punc)) {
update(text.get(i));
}
// -- otherwise, present user options
else {
for(int x = 0; x < dictionary.size(); x++) {
int compare = computeLevenshteinDistance(punc, dictionary.get(x));
if(compare < 2) {
suggestions.add(dictionary.get(x));
}
}
//if the suggestiin array is empty
if(suggestions.size() == 0){
System.out.println("\nThere seems to be no words similar to " + puncc);
System.out.println("Would you like to add this word to the dictionary, or write your own alternative?");
System.out.println("+) Add to Dictionary");
System.out.println("-) Write your own Alternative\n");
BufferedReader reader2 = new BufferedReader(new InputStreamReader(System.in));
// Reading Data using readLine
String input2 = reader2.readLine();
switch(input2) {
case "+":
System.out.println(puncc + " has been added to the dictionary!");
updateDictionary(punc);
updateD(text.get(i));
//suggestions.clear();
break;
case "-":
updatetxt(text.get(i));
//suggestions.clear();
break;
}
}
else {
//System.out.println(Arrays.toString(suggestions.toArray()));
//System.out.println(Arrays.toString(options.toArray()));
Scanner UserInput = new Scanner(System.in);
String input1;
System.out.println("\n" + puncc + " was not found, we have some suggestions for you");
System.out.println(suggestionList());
System.out.println("+) Add to dictionary");
System.out.println("-) Not here? Write an alternative!\n");
BufferedReader reader1 = new BufferedReader(new InputStreamReader(System.in));
// Reading Data using readLine
input1 = UserInput.nextLine();
//switch method to identify every possible input
switch(input1) {
case "1":
update(suggestions.get(0));
System.out.println(punc + " has been changed to " + suggestions.get(0));
suggestions.clear();
break;
case "2":
update(suggestions.get(1));
System.out.println(punc + " has been changed to " + suggestions.get(1));
suggestions.clear();
break;
case "3":
update(suggestions.get(2));
System.out.println(punc + " has been changed to " + suggestions.get(2));
suggestions.clear();
break;
case "4":
update(suggestions.get(3));
System.out.println(punc + " has been changed to " + suggestions.get(3));
suggestions.clear();
break;
case "5":
update(suggestions.get(4));
System.out.println(punc + " has been changed to " + suggestions.get(4));
suggestions.clear();
break;
case "+":
System.out.println(puncc + " has been added to the dictionary!");
updateD(text.get(i));
updateDictionary(punc);
suggestions.clear();
break;
case "-":
updatetxt(text.get(i));
suggestions.clear();
break;
default:
System.out.println("Wrong input! Please enter a different input");
return;
}
}
}
}
}
//updates dictionary.txt file with any new strings
public static void updateDictionary(String y){
try(FileWriter fw = new FileWriter("dictionary.txt", true);
BufferedWriter bw = new BufferedWriter(fw);
PrintWriter out = new PrintWriter(bw)) {
out.println("\n" + y);
}
catch(IOException e) {
System.out.println("You have an error? Maybe check if there is a Text2 file");
}
}
//updates the second text file with alternative strings
public static void updatetxt(String t){
Reader r = new InputStreamReader(System.in);
BufferedReader br = new BufferedReader(r);
String str = null;
try(FileWriter fw = new FileWriter("Text2.txt", true);
BufferedWriter bw = new BufferedWriter(fw);
PrintWriter out = new PrintWriter(bw))
{
//prompt the user to input data
System.out.println("Please enter your alternative");
str = br.readLine();
out.print(str + " ");
out.close();
}
catch (IOException e) {
e.printStackTrace();
}
}
//add to the dictionary array
public static void updateD(String d){
dictionary.add(d);
try(FileWriter fw = new FileWriter("Text2.txt", true);
BufferedWriter bw = new BufferedWriter(fw);
PrintWriter out = new PrintWriter(bw)) {
out.print(d + " ");
}
catch(IOException e) {
System.out.println("You have an error? Maybe check if there is a Text2 file");
}
}
public static void update(String s){
try(FileWriter fw = new FileWriter("Text2.txt", true);
BufferedWriter bw = new BufferedWriter(fw);
PrintWriter out = new PrintWriter(bw)) {
out.print(s + " ");
}
catch(IOException e) {
System.out.println("You have an error? Maybe check if there is a Text2 file");
}
}
//using Levenshtein, for loop is used to create the suggestions
public static String suggestionList() {
int counter = 1;
String menu = " ";
for(int i = 0; i < suggestions.size(); i++) {
if (counter < 8){
menu += ("\n" + counter + ") " + suggestions.get(i));
counter++;
}
}
return menu;
}
private static int minimum(int a, int b, int c) {
return Math.min(Math.min(a, b), c);
}
//Levenshtein algorithm,to compute if any strings in the dictionary are similar to the string that is selected from the text file
public static int computeLevenshteinDistance(String lhs, String rhs) {
int[][] distance = new int[lhs.length() + 1][rhs.length() + 1];
for (int i = 0; i <= lhs.length(); i++)
distance[i][0] = i;
for (int j = 1; j <= rhs.length(); j++)
distance[0][j] = j;
for (int i = 1; i <= lhs.length(); i++)
for (int j = 1; j <= rhs.length(); j++)
distance[i][j] = minimum(
distance[i - 1][j] + 1,
distance[i][j - 1] + 1,
distance[i - 1][j - 1] + ((lhs.charAt(i - 1) == rhs.charAt(j - 1)) ? 0 : 1));
return distance[lhs.length()][rhs.length()];
}
}
